Yale Entertainment Hires Ex-Sony Exec as Production Head – Deadline


exclusive: Yale Entertainment Producer Nick Phillips has been hired as head of production.

As part of this role, Phillips will work closely with Yale Presidents Jordan Yale Levine and Jordan Beckman, as well as the Yale production and operations team, to manage and oversee the company’s upcoming films.

Phillips will be responsible for the entire production process, from identifying potential projects, budgeting, scheduling, crew hiring, managing principal photography, to directing the film’s post-production and distribution.Upcoming projects at Yale include David Duchovny’s Bucky F-ing Dent and the recently announced breitenbushStarring Regina Hall.

Phillips began his career at Miramax/Dimension Films in New York City in 1997 as a receptionist, followed by a stint as an assistant in the Commerce Department before becoming an executive in 2000.During his time at Dimension, Phillips worked on several franchises, including Scream, Halloween, Hellscream, Doctor Strange, Werewolf Night, Highlander, and crow. He also appeared in season 3 of the project green light. He was promoted to corporate vice president of development and production.

In 2005, Phillips joined Sony Pictures Entertainment as Senior Vice President of Development and Production, and from 2012 to 2017, Phillips served as Executive Vice President of independent record label Revolver Picture Company. Most recently, he was Head of Production at startup studio/streaming platform CreatorPlus.

“Nick brings a wealth of knowledge and experience from his years in the industry and is a great addition to the ever-expanding Yale Entertainment team,” said Jordan Yale-Levin and Jordan Beckman. As the company continues to produce its largest and most commercially viable film to date, we knew we had to find a great production executive – and Nick was absolutely up to the task.”

Phillips added: “I couldn’t be more excited to be joining the fantastic team at this successful, fast-growing company. From Jordans and those around me, this is a group of people who are committed to making interesting, high-quality independent films, and I look forward to Looking forward to continuing to work with them, as well as the extremely skilled filmmakers and talent involved in our upcoming titles.”

Yale Entertainment is represented by APA and Lon Haber & Co.
